Doggerland and Lost Frontiers leads in Science magazine’s feature article – EUROPE’S LOST FRONTIER in this week’s magazine (https://science.sciencemag.org/content/367/6477/499)

Drawing on work by Lost Frontiers academics and amateur finds from the area, and with a map produced in collaboration with Merle Muru,while working on her postdoctoral project “Coastal Change: modelling submerged landscapes and prehistoric human colonisation of the southern North Sea basin” (funded by Estonian Research Council grant no PUTJD829), Simon Fitch and other members of the team, the article provides an overview of much of the work carried out by the project and including the recent work with VLIZ and our Belgian collaborators.
